Ex 7 Climbing. Aim To enter and maintain a steady full power climb then to return to level flight at a predetermined altitude, also to enter and maintain a steady cruise climb. The Forces. More power is required in a climb to balance the increase in drag from weight - PowerPoint PPT PresentationTRANSCRIPT
